Trending Kitchen Countertop Materials
In today’s contemporary kitchens, the choice of kitchen countertop materials is vast and varied, reflecting the diverse aesthetics and functionalities sought by modern homeowners. Among the trending options, quartz stands out for its durability, ease of maintenance, and wide range of colors and patterns that mimic natural stone. Its non-porous surface makes it highly resistant to stains and scratches, making it a top choice for busy households.
Another popular material is granite, renowned for its timeless elegance and indelible beauty. Each piece of granite is unique, offering a natural, organic appeal that adds character to any kitchen. While more porous than quartz, proper sealing can effectively prevent staining, making granite a durable and low-maintenance option. Beyond these, materials like marble, solid surface, and even wood are making a comeback, each with its distinct aesthetic and performance attributes, catering to diverse tastes and lifestyles in modern kitchens.
